Listed below is information regarding how help texts can be added for description fields, key words, responsibility roles, activities, control model columns and views.
What is a help text?
The system provides different help texts. Some are predetermined by the system, or refer to the manual, but many of the texts can be adapted so that they fit your set-up.
One example which is shown below is a help text for a description field, which helps the user understand what is meant to be entered in that field.

Help texts for description fields
Go to Description fields in the administration.
Click on "Description" to update the help text for your description field:
Save at the bottom of the page.
The help text is shown in the node's "edit-window" by clicking on the question mark:
Help texts for control model columns
A descriptive text for a column is added through "Edit control model column" (3) in the administration:
Add desired text in this field:
The help text is then shown in views when hovering above the column title:
Help texts for responsibility roles
Go to Responsibility roles in the administration. Then click on the wrench for the chosen responsibility role:
Add the desired help text in the field and save:
The help text is then shown in the node's edit-window:
Help texts for key words
Go to the adminsitration and select "Key word groups". Click on the wrench for the key word group that you want to edit:
Add your desired help text in the field and save:
The help text is then shown in the node's edit-window:
Help texts for activities
Go to Activity settings in the administration and select the tab "Help texts".
Update the help texts you want to change and save:
The help texts that you write here are shown if the user clicks on the question mark in the view. The help text will apply to all levels. The helptext for status is also shown in the follow-up-window.
Help texts for views
Go to the view settings, for example via the cogwheel in the view on the right hand side.
Then select Edit. You do this by selecting the cogwheel (1) and then click on the "Edit-button" (2). To add a help text you add the desired information in the appropriate field (3).
Add your desired text. There are plenty of editing options for this text and can use different fonts, lists, images and more. There is also the option to paste information from Word or Excel.
There is a possibility to select the option "Show help text when opening the view" (4). You can always access the help text by clicking on the question mark.
